    Hello, I also go to stanford. Stage 4 here. My onc is Dr. Fisher and my thorasic surgeon was Dr. Whyte. I had 2 spots in my left lower lobe and they did a lobectomy in Nov of 2007. I had colon cancer in 9/06, liver resection with Dr Soo at Stanford in feb of 07 along with chemo. The lung spots showed up after 3 months of clear Ct scan. My last scan in March was clear. I have had so far a good experience there but it is crowded. I did push for surgery quickly. Currently, I am not on anything for long reasons but if something shows up in CEA or Ct scan then its back toi either surgery and/or chemo
